|
@@ -1,21 +1,23 @@
|
|
|
import React from 'react';
|
|
|
import { BrowserRouter, Routes, Route } from 'react-router-dom';
|
|
|
import { Auth, Login, Logout, NavBar, Overview } from './components';
|
|
|
-import { AuthProvider } from './contexts';
|
|
|
+import { AuthProvider, TimeProvider } from './contexts';
|
|
|
import './App.css';
|
|
|
|
|
|
const App: React.FC = () => (
|
|
|
<>
|
|
|
<BrowserRouter>
|
|
|
- <AuthProvider>
|
|
|
- <NavBar />
|
|
|
- <Routes>
|
|
|
- <Route index element={<Login />} />
|
|
|
- <Route path='/auth' element={<Auth />} />
|
|
|
- <Route path='/overview' element={<Overview />} />
|
|
|
- <Route path='/logout' element={<Logout />} />
|
|
|
- </Routes>
|
|
|
- </AuthProvider>
|
|
|
+ <TimeProvider>
|
|
|
+ <AuthProvider>
|
|
|
+ <NavBar />
|
|
|
+ <Routes>
|
|
|
+ <Route index element={<Login />} />
|
|
|
+ <Route path='/auth' element={<Auth />} />
|
|
|
+ <Route path='/overview' element={<Overview />} />
|
|
|
+ <Route path='/logout' element={<Logout />} />
|
|
|
+ </Routes>
|
|
|
+ </AuthProvider>
|
|
|
+ </TimeProvider>
|
|
|
</BrowserRouter>
|
|
|
</>
|
|
|
);
|